
Farmhouse with a Stooping Peasant-woman in a Blue Dress
Vincent van Gogh·1885
Historical Context
Van Gogh's 1885 Farmhouse with a Stooping Peasant Woman in a Blue Dress belongs to the series of Nuenen subjects documenting peasant life in its specific built and agricultural setting. The blue dress of the stooping woman provides a chromatic note unusual in his typically dark Dutch palette — a moment of color in an otherwise earthen composition. The farmhouse behind her roots the figure in its specific material world, connecting her labor to the domestic space it serves. The work is currently in a private collection or unlocated.
Technical Analysis
The stooping figure in her blue dress is the composition's chromatic center, the blue providing contrast within the dark earthen surroundings. Van Gogh renders both figure and farmhouse with the careful observation of someone who knows this environment well. His Nuenen palette is typically dark, the blue dress standing out within that register.
